Answer: Abused children are at high risk of mental illness, depression, low performance in the class, less active, some of the children becomes aggressive.

It is important to identify the child abuser as by knowing the way, methods they approach towards the child. The child abuse can be in any form such as physical abuse, mental abuse etc.

When child is being abused, there are certain changes in his/her behavior. The child becomes depressed, silent, not participating in sports, fear, nightmares etc.

Sexual abuse in children has become common, those abusers such as drinkers, mentally sick people tends to does these activities. Those children who are most likely to be abused such as those who are introvert, small age, less attention from their parents etc. Children with low poverty status are easily targeted.
